Question for the others watching exercism/xclojure: At this point in the exercises, how do we want the simplified meetup example to work? The Java example uses a switch statement, which I could replicate with a cond
, but dispatching based on the "schedule" argument could also be done with an inner function using Protocols or Multimethods. I'm just not sure if protocols have been introduced at this point in the exercises for Clojure.
Thoughts? Suggestions?
